Source code for rsrtx.Implementations.Trigger.Holdoff.Scaling

from ....Internal.Core import Core
from ....Internal.CommandsGroup import CommandsGroup
from ....Internal import Conversions
from .... import repcap


# noinspection PyPep8Naming,PyAttributeOutsideInit,SpellCheckingInspection
class ScalingCls:
	"""
	| Commands in total: 1
	| Subgroups: 0
	| Direct child commands: 1
	"""

	def __init__(self, core: Core, parent):
		self._core = core
		self._cmd_group = CommandsGroup("scaling", core, parent)

[docs] def set(self, auto_time_scl: float, trigger=repcap.Trigger.Default) -> None: """ ``TRIGger<*>:HOLDoff:SCALing`` \n Snippet: ``driver.trigger.holdoff.scaling.set(auto_time_scl = 1.0, trigger = repcap.Trigger.Default)`` \n Sets the auto time scaling factor the horizontal scale is multipied with: Auto time = Auto time scaling * Horizontal scale. The setting is relevant if the holdoff mode is set to AUTO. See also: \n - method ``RsRtx.trigger.holdoff.mode.set()`` - method ``RsRtx.trigger.holdoff.autoTime.get()`` :param auto_time_scl: 1E-3 to 1000 :param trigger: optional repeated capability selector. Default value: Nr1 (settable in the interface 'Trigger') """ param = Conversions.decimal_value_to_str(auto_time_scl) trigger_cmd_val = self._cmd_group.get_repcap_cmd_value(trigger, repcap.Trigger) self._core.io.write_with_opc(f'TRIGger{trigger_cmd_val}:HOLDoff:SCALing {param}')
